Top Piano Schools
Choosing the right school can be a daunting task, given the variety available. Here are some top-rated piano schools in Sydney:
- Sydney Conservatorium of Music: Known for its rigorous curriculum and distinguished faculty.
- Australian Institute of Music: Offers a contemporary approach with courses in performance and composition.
- Inner West Music College: Focuses on nurturing young talent with a comprehensive program.
Private Tutors
For those who prefer one-on-one instruction, Sydney boasts a plethora of private tutors. Personalized lessons can be tailored to fit your schedule and learning style. Many tutors offer in-home sessions, providing flexibility and convenience.
When selecting a tutor, consider their teaching experience and student reviews. A good tutor will not only teach you the technical aspects of piano playing but will also inspire and motivate you to explore your musical potential.

Community Centers and Workshops
Community centers across Sydney offer workshops and group classes that are perfect for beginners. These sessions provide a social environment where you can learn alongside others, share experiences, and even perform in group recitals.
Workshops often cover a variety of topics, from basic techniques to advanced music theory, and are a great way to immerse yourself in the local music scene without a long-term commitment.
Online Learning Options
In recent years, online piano lessons have gained popularity. Many platforms offer comprehensive courses that you can follow at your own pace. This is an excellent option for those with busy schedules or who prefer learning from the comfort of their home.
Online lessons often include video tutorials, interactive exercises, and feedback from instructors. While they may lack the personal touch of in-person lessons, the flexibility and variety they offer can be appealing.
